The Cabinet of Ministers has cleared the implementation of multipurpose projects under public-private-partnerships (PPP) in the lands allocated for the Department of Posts to generate additional income.

The proposal to this effect submitted by Mass Media Minister Dullas Alahapperuma was approved by the Cabinet of Ministers on Monday.

“The Department of Post consists of a network of 654 main post offices and 3,410 sub-post offices. Of the 654 main post offices, 154 post offices are operated in private buildings on lease,” Cabinet Co-Spokesman and Mass Media Minister said at the post-Cabinet meeting media briefing yesterday.

He also said that despite the fact that plots of land have been allocated in several provinces for the construction of post offices, those proposed construction of buildings has not taken place due to lack of sufficient funds.

Annually, Rs. 400 million is spent on the Postal Department and the Minister said the new move will help boost revenue.
